Review: call time – Steve Jones
  • 4.5 stars
  • Release date: 11th May
  • Buy on Amazon

Reading this I realised how many female lead and authored books I read. This was a really nice departure from that, although I did have a few reservations because it was a very different style and character that I’m used to.

To begin with I noticed that there was a lack of descriptions of things but it actually helped speed through the book, I read this in one sitting and couldn’t stop. I did enjoy that it was almost like watching a movie, really fast paced. I could see this being adapted for the screen.

I think the only downside, for me, was I would’ve loved to see either a couple more timelines or some more time spent with the timelines.

It’s such a cool concept with some amazing twists and turns, the main character Bob/Rob/Robert redeemed himself throughout the book that the final few pages had me on the edge of my seat!

I really can’t wait to read more from Steve and although it was a quick read it’s a book I’ll be thinking about for a long time, and I really hope it gets developed into something else.
